中文摘要 | 微透析取樣技術是生物醫學分析上非常省時、簡便之取樣技術。使用之微透析探針採用商業化產品。樣品溶解及取樣過程僅使用純水。取樣、淨化及分析過程是在直接、動態、自動化中完成。本研究發展之線上微透析取樣技術結合高效液相層析/紫外光偵測系統,可同時定量美白化妝水、乳液、乳膏中維他命C葡萄糖苷、麴酸、維他命B₃。基於真實樣品之分析物不是微量及偵測波長之剛硬性的考量下,本實驗選擇254nm做為後續分析之偵測波長。測得維他命C葡萄糖苷、麴酸、維他命B₃之濃度線性範圍分別介於0.068-304、0.071-284、0.024-488 µg mL¯¹,線性相關係數依序是0.9982、0.9999、0.9999,偵測極限分別為0.01、0.01、0.007 µg mL¯¹。添加回收率介於92~106%,變異係數介於3.9~8.7%。本研究將所開發之分析方法,應用在六種真實樣品中之美白劑含量測定。測得之結果顯示本分析方法具高精密度與高準確度。 |
英文摘要 | Microdialysis sampling (MDS) technique is a simple and easy process and frequently use in biomedical analyses. Microdialysis probe used was a commercial product. Only deionized water was used as the solvent in the sample dissolved and sampling. The sampling, clean-up, and analysis processes can be accomplished in direct, dynamic, and automatic procedures. A simultaneous determination of ascorbyl glucoside (AA-2G), kojic acid (KA), and niacinamide (VitB₃) in bleaching cosmetics using on-line MDS coupled with HPLC/UV has been developed. Considering the rigidness of detection wavelength and the levels of the analytes in the samples are high (0.1%-2%). The analytes were all detected by ultraviolet light absorption at the wavelength of 254 nm. Calibration curves were found to be linear in the 0.068~304 (AA-2G), 0.071~284 (KA), and 0.024~488μg mL¯¹ (VitB₃) respectively. The correlation coefficients of linear regression analysis were with the range 0.9982-0.9999. The detection limits of these compounds are 0.01 for AA-2G, 0.01 for KA, and 0.007 μg mL¯¹ for VitB₃ respectively. The recovery values were in the range 92-106% with good reproducibility (R.S.D. = 3.9-83.7%). Six commercial available bleaching cosmetics were assayed using the procedure developed in this study. The results obtained confirm the precision of the method and confirm the label claim on the cosmetics. |
